Développeur(euse) Logiciel Principal /Lead Software Developer

Eaton • Montreal, Canada

Company

Eaton

Location

Montreal, Canada

Type

Full Time

Job Description

Aperçu du poste:

La division des systèmes et services d'ingénierie électrique d'Eaton est actuellement à la recherche d'un(e) Développeur Logiciel Principal. Ce poste est basé au Centre d'Innovation des Amériques d'Eaton à Brossard, Québec, Canada. Ce rôle offre des opportunités de travail hybride, ainsi que des avantages sociaux dès le premier jour. Les candidats doivent résider à moins de 80 km de Brossard, Québec, Canada.

Il n'y a pas de meilleur moment pour rejoindre Eaton que dans cette ère passionnante de la gestion de l'énergie. Nous réinventons l'innovation en adaptant les technologies numériques (appareils connectés, modèles de données et informations) pour transformer la gestion de l'énergie pour une utilisation plus sûre, plus durable et plus efficace. Nos équipes collaborent pour construire les meilleures solutions numériques pour nos clients. Nous recherchons des talents numériques qui souhaitent contribuer à définir la direction de cette transformation numérique et à créer de nouvelles façons de travailler et de penser, pour nous-mêmes et pour nos clients.

Want more jobs like this?

Get jobs in Montreal, Canada del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.


CYME International T&D d'Eaton est un chef de file mondial en matière de logiciels de simulation et d'analyse de réseaux électriques. CYME a acquis une solide réputation tant par son expertise technique que son service après-vente diligent. Nos solutions sont au cœur de milliers de projets en T&D dans plus de 100 pays à travers le monde. En tant que membre d'une équipe de développement multidisciplinaire, le développeur logiciel principal participera à la conception et au développement d'applications web et de solutions d'automatisation dans le domaine de l'analyse et de la modélisation des réseaux de distribution d'électricité et des énergies renouvelables.

Principales fonctions:

  • Analyse les spĂ©cifications techniques et les exigences techniques de projets complexes.
  • Conçoit, dĂ©veloppe, et effectue la maintenance de code source efficace, rĂ©utilisable, et fiable.
  • PrĂ©pare des plans de tests dĂ©taillĂ©s.
  • Collabore avec l'Ă©quipe de support afin de fournir une expĂ©rience client inĂ©galĂ©e.
  • Dirige toutes les Ă©tapes du cycle de dĂ©veloppement en collaboration avec le chef de projet.
  • Dirige des ateliers de conception et des activitĂ©s de dĂ©ploiement de projets Ă  la fois localement et sur les sites des clients.
  • Dirige l'Ă©valuation et la sĂ©lection des technologies.
  • Agit comme mentor, superviseur ou chef d'Ă©quipe.

Qualifications:

Qualifications requises:

  • BaccalaurĂ©at en informatique, gĂ©nie logiciel ou programme connexe d'un Ă©tablissement agréé.
  • Minimum de 8 annĂ©es d'expĂ©rience en dĂ©veloppement logiciel.
  • Minimum de 5 annĂ©es d'expĂ©rience avec C#.
  • ExpĂ©rience comme dĂ©veloppeur logiciel principal ou rĂ´le similaire.
  • ExpĂ©rience avec Jira, GitHub ou des outils de dĂ©veloppement logiciel similaires.
  • ExpĂ©rience avec SQL, LINQ et les bases de donnĂ©es : Microsoft SQL Server, Oracle Database.
  • ExpĂ©rience en dĂ©veloppement logiciel agile : Scrum.
  • MaĂ®trise de l'anglais et du français (capacitĂ© Ă  travailler dans les deux langues). La maĂ®trise du français et de l'anglais est essentielle pour ce poste afin de communiquer avec des collègues, clients et partenaires situĂ©s au QuĂ©bec ou Ă  l'extĂ©rieur de la province, ainsi que pour comprendre les documents techniques dans le domaine de notre industrie.
  • ĂŠtre autorisĂ© lĂ©galement Ă  travailler au Canada sans parrainage de l'entreprise maintenant et Ă  l'avenir.
  • Aucune aide Ă  la rĂ©installation n'est offerte pour ce poste. Les candidats doivent rĂ©sider dans un rayon de 80 kilomètres des installations de Brossard.

Qualifications préférables:

  • ExpĂ©rience en dĂ©veloppement Web.
  • ExpĂ©rience en architecture logicielle.
  • ExpĂ©rience avec d'autres langages de programmation : C++, Python.

Compétences:

  • Avoir de bonnes aptitudes de communication, de relations interpersonnelles et d'organisation.
  • ĂŠtre en mesure d'analyser et de rĂ©soudre des problèmes complexes.
  • Savoir prioriser son travail adĂ©quatement et gĂ©rer son temps efficacement.

Position Overview:

Eaton's Electrical Engineering Services and Systems division is currently seeking a Lead Software Developer. This role is based in our Eaton Americas Innovation Center in Brossard, Québec, Canada and offers hybrid work opportunities, as well as benefits from day one. Candidates must reside within 80km of Brossard, Québec, Canada.

There is no better time to join Eaton than in this exciting era of power management. We're reimagining innovation by adapting digital technologies - connected devices, data models and insights - to transform power management for safer and more sustainable and efficient power use. Our teams are collaborating to build the best digital solutions for our customers. We are looking for digital talent who wants to help set the direction for this digital transformation and create new ways of working and thinking, for ourselves and our customers.

Eaton's CYME International T&D is a world-class Power Engineering Solutions provider with an established reputation for customer responsiveness and technical expertise. Our solutions stand behind thousands of T&D projects in over 100 countries around the world. As part of a multidisciplinary development team, the lead software developer will participate in the design and development of web applications and automation solutions in the field of analysis and modeling of electricity distribution networks and renewable energies.

Essential Responsibilities:

  • Analyzes technical specifications and engineering requirements.
  • Designs, builds, and maintains efficient, reusable, and reliable code.
  • Prepares detailed software verification test plans.
  • Collaborates with the support team to provide an unsurpassed customer experience.
  • Leads all stages of the development cycle in collaboration with the project manager.
  • Leads design workshops and project deployment activities both locally and at customer sites.
  • Leads technology evaluation and selection.
  • Acts as a mentor, supervisor or team leader.

Qualifications:

Required Qualifications:

  • Bachelor's degree in computer science, software engineering, or related from an accredited institution.
  • Minimum of 8 years of experience in software development.
  • Minimum of 5 years of experience with C#.
  • Experience as lead software developer, supervisor, team leader, or similar role.
  • Experience with Jira and GitHub, or similar software development tools.
  • Experience with SQL, LINQ, and databases: Microsoft SQL Server, Oracle Database.
  • Experience in agile software development: Scrum.
  • Fluency in English and French (working proficiency in both languages). Fluency in French and English is required for this position to communicate with colleagues, customers, and partners located inside and outside of QuĂ©bec, as well as to understand technical documentation in the field of our industry.
  • Must be legally authorized to work in Canada without corporate sponsorship now or in the future.
  • No relocated offered for this position. Candidates must live within an 80-kilometer radius of the Brossard facility.

Preferred Qualifications:

  • Experience in Web development.
  • Experience in software architecture.
  • Experience with other programming languages: Python, C++.

Skills:

  • Good communication, interpersonal and organizational skills.
  • Strong analytical aptitude and complex problem-solving skills.
  • Effective time management, prioritization skills.

We are committed to ensuring equal employment opportunities for job applicants and employees. Our recruitment processes use balanced selection criteria and avoid unlawful discrimination against applicants on the basis of their age, colour, disability, marital status, national origin, gender, gender identity, genetic information, race or racial origin, religion, sexual orientation or any other status protected or required by law.

Apply Now

Date Posted

12/20/2024

Views

0

Back to Job Listings ❤️Add To Job List Company Info View Company Reviews
Positive
Subjectivity Score: 0.95

Similar Jobs

Senior Manager - New Business Sales (Bilingual English/French) - Maple

Views in the last 30 days - 0

Maple a fastgrowing health tech company founded in 2015 is seeking a Senior Manager of New Business Sales to lead revenue growth within their New Busi...

View Details

Intermediate Software Engineer - Athennian

Views in the last 30 days - 0

Athennian a company managing over 370000 business entities worldwide is seeking an experienced Intermediate Software Engineer The role involves design...

View Details

Data Scientist - FACT DSE - Wealthsimple

Views in the last 30 days - 0

Wealthsimple is a leading Canadian fintech company with over 4 million users and 50 billion in assets They are hiring a data scientist for their FACT ...

View Details

Principal Product Manager - Insurance Products - Gusto, Inc.

Views in the last 30 days - 0

Gusto a leading software for small businesses is expanding its health insurance portfolio to meet customer demand and improve access for SMB owners an...

View Details

Staff Software Developer - Vidyard

Views in the last 30 days - 0

Vidyard is hiring a Staff Software Developer to join their Core Team responsible for designing building and scaling the core functionality of their vi...

View Details

Jr. Service Desk Specialist - StackAdapt

Views in the last 30 days - 0

StackAdapt is a selfserve advertising platform offering multichannel solutions including native display video connected TV audio ingame and digital ou...

View Details